How do I become a warehouse lead in Florida?

To become a warehouse lead in Florida, you typ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, with an associate's or bachelor's degree preferred. Gaining 2-4 years of experience in warehouse operations and demonstrating leadership skills are essential for this role. Familiarity with inventory management, strong communication abilities, and proficiency in warehouse management software will enhance your qualifications. Additionally, obtaining a forklift certification and being flexible with shift availability will further improve your chances of securing a position.

How long does it take to become a warehouse lead in FL?

Becoming a warehouse lead in Florida typically takes about 2 to 4 years of experience in warehouse operations, along with proven leadership skills. A high school diploma is the minimum requirement, but an associate's or bachelor's degree may be preferred by some employers. Candidates should also possess strong knowledge of inventory management and logistics, as well as excellent communication skills. Additional qualifications, such as forklift certification and proficiency in warehouse management software, can enhance job prospects and expedite career advancement.
